Fyi, you can write greentext-like text by writing a backslash before the greater-than character:

> This is how it looks like when submitted
\> This is how you write it
\\> This is how the previous line looks like as I'm writing this
\\\\> ditto

... all of this assuming your client renders my comment correctly.
